Abstract

In July 1987, FUJITSU announced new supercomputers, the FACOM VP series E model, and its maximum performance ranges from 220 MFLOPS to 1.7 GFLOPS. This paper describes FUJITSU’S FACOM VP series E model from the view point of hardware, software and system configuration.
